So one of my favorite features of the 360 was the ability to stream media (video) from my desktop over wifi. This allowed me to watch downloaded content in my living room on my tv. Pretty standard stuff these days, right?
Well.... Does the One not have this capability!?!? I have googled and see that you can use something called 'Play To' from your windows 8 PC to send video the one. But you can not browse/start playback from the One. You need to initiate it from your windows pc. Which becomes a big problem when your source desktop is a Mac. Previously i used software called 'Rivet' on my Mac, which essentially turns your computer into a networked storage device. Hoping there is a software update for the One to rectify this shortly. Right now I am having to keep my 360 also hooked up, so that I can stream media. Am I missing something somewhere to enable this? |
